M
Motomu Sekiguchi Review of Amplify
Amplify is a top-notch company to work with. Their...
Amplify is a top-notch company to work with. Their website is easy to navigate and their team is always ready to assist. I really appreciate their professionalism and attention to detail. Highly recommended!

Comments: